Does GameStop have competitive pay?

The average GameStop salary in the United States is $31,519 per year. GameStop salaries range between $17,000 a year in the bottom 10th percentile to $56,000 in the top 90th percentile. GameStop pays $15.15 an hour on average. Geographic location also impacts GameStop salaries.

What perks do GameStop employees get?

Most Popular Benefits at GameStop Corp.
  • Company Store Discount. Employees: 67.
  • Paid Holidays / Vacation. Employees: 60.
  • Paid Sick Leave. Employees: 57.
  • Casual Dress/Atmosphere. Employees: 49.
  • 401(k) Employees: 43.
  • Flex-Time / Flexible Schedule. Employees: 23.
  • Life Insurance/Disability. Employees: 20.

Does GameStop pay overtime?

Indeed's survey asked over 172 current and former employees what the overtime policy was for their role at GameStop. The most popular answer was there's no overtime. When asked about overtime rates, 71% said that there was no overtime pay. Learn more about benefits at GameStop.

How much money do you make in GameStop?

Hourly pay at GameStop Corp. ranges from an average of $10.49 to $19.87 an hour. GameStop Corp. employees with the job title Retail Store Manager make the most with an average hourly rate of $17.18, while employees with the title Sales Associate make the least with an average hourly rate of $11.45.

How much discount do GameStop employees get?

Some stores will extend store discounts to immediate family, but not GameStop. Their employee discount is usually only 10% and that 10% doesn't extend past the employee who works there. If your family or friends come into the store expecting to save money, they're going to be out of luck—this is against store policy.

Do GameStop employees get breaks?

You generally get 1-2 10 min paid breaks and a 30 min unpaid break if you work 5hours or more per gamestop policy. part-time employees don't get anything but a smoke break.
